	         <title>Logo file types</title>
	         <link>http://www.pagedesignltd.com/blog/post/130085/logo-file-types/</link>
	         	         <description>I often get asked what file types I supply when designing a logo. Rather than get into technical speak I explain that I provide two types of files - vector(print) or raster (web use/internal documents). The vector files can be enlarged as big as the moon or as small as a stamp, without losing any quality - the curves remain smooth, the text crisp, the colour true and consistent... I stress that even if my client is unable to open these files, to please keep them safe as these are the &#039;blueprints...</description>
